diff options
| author | Greg Roach <greg@subaqua.co.uk> | 2022-11-15 13:20:16 +0000 |
|---|---|---|
| committer | Greg Roach <greg@subaqua.co.uk> | 2022-11-18 11:55:56 +0000 |
| commit | 748dbe155a6d19d66918ad136947fa23ee8f8469 (patch) | |
| tree | ed4743592d3b0aea968f9cbae7e5d32c00b546fe /app/Http/RequestHandlers/MergeRecordsAction.php | |
| parent | f783aa1f4cd6d54a90d24a3d6be2996a3951fced (diff) | |
| download | webtrees-748dbe155a6d19d66918ad136947fa23ee8f8469.tar.gz webtrees-748dbe155a6d19d66918ad136947fa23ee8f8469.tar.bz2 webtrees-748dbe155a6d19d66918ad136947fa23ee8f8469.zip | |
Use Validator
Diffstat (limited to 'app/Http/RequestHandlers/MergeRecordsAction.php')
| -rw-r--r-- | app/Http/RequestHandlers/MergeRecordsAction.php | 7 |
1 files changed, 2 insertions, 5 deletions
diff --git a/app/Http/RequestHandlers/MergeRecordsAction.php b/app/Http/RequestHandlers/MergeRecordsAction.php index 9fbf74d3e0..7fbb3d4c17 100644 --- a/app/Http/RequestHandlers/MergeRecordsAction.php +++ b/app/Http/RequestHandlers/MergeRecordsAction.php @@ -41,11 +41,8 @@ class MergeRecordsAction implements RequestHandlerInterface public function handle(ServerRequestInterface $request): ResponseInterface { $tree = Validator::attributes($request)->tree(); - - $params = (array) $request->getParsedBody(); - - $xref1 = $params['xref1'] ?? ''; - $xref2 = $params['xref2'] ?? ''; + $xref1 = Validator::parsedBody($request)->isXref()->string('xref1'); + $xref2 = Validator::parsedBody($request)->isXref()->string('xref2'); // Merge record2 into record1 $record1 = Registry::gedcomRecordFactory()->make($xref1, $tree); |
